## v4.2.0 — Changed defaults (Larkspell timetable solver)

Solver defaults changed: max iterations raised, room-conflict penalty doubled, backtracking enabled by default. Existing deployments with explicit overrides are unaffected; everyone else gets the new behavior on upgrade. Rationale in the design note. The new default configuration shipped with this release is as follows.

service settings:
[casax]
port = 6379
team = rusir
host = casax.zemvarhq.corp
region = outer-4
access_code = ac_9808ce
timeout_ms = 1500

Action item from the Mirewater tide-table widget incident. Owner: release manager. Widget cached stale harbor offsets after the DST change, showing tides six hours off for two days. Required: add a cache-invalidation check to the release checklist, block deploys when offset tables are older than 24 hours, and verify the Saltgate harbor feed before each cut. Deadline: next release. Checklist template and sign-off procedure are documented on the internal page below.

wiki page, kawif-bajep: https://artifactory.zarqelforge.internal/issue/browse/display/display/projects/spaces/secrets/000fe6ec5a46af29355003e1

Hey plugin folks — quick note on the Ledgerline payroll export change in this review. We're moving from the fixed-width v2 layout to delimited v3, and your parsers will need to handle the new trailer record and per-batch checksums. Old exports keep working through the deprecation window, but the writer now chunks large runs so memory stays sane on the Harwick-size tenants. If you buffer whole files today, please switch to streaming. The chunking and window constants are pinned as follows:

constants for bawif-kawif:
QUOTAS = {
    "ulaael": 5,
    "holael": 10,
}